Behind The Lens

Location

In The Wave of Faith was taken in Naga City, Camarines Sur, Philippines.

Time

This was shot on September 20, 2014 during the celebration of Peñafrancia Festival. I can honestly say that while I was taking this photo, I was experiencing goosebumps & I was literally in tears.

Lighting

I just used the ambient light.

Equipment

I used Canon EOS 60D with Tamron 17-50.

Inspiration

I am a devotee of Our Lady of Peñafrancia whom we called INA. Almost every year, I go to Naga to attend the festival & to take photos of the celebration. I consider taking picture of INA as part of my devotion. Peñafrancia Fiesta is both religious & cultural festival. It is celebrated in more than 300 years. Bikolanos are known children of the Blessed Mother as they fondly called Mary as INA. This is part of Bikolano’s Catholic spirituality. Every September, all roads are leading to Naga City, Camarines Sur where six million Bicolanos from Bicol and abroad flock to the city to pay homage to Our Lady of Peñafrancia . Peñafrancia Festival is considered the biggest and most popular religious event in the Philippines. As a Filipino & Bikolano, it is both an honor & reponsobility to promote our culture to the world. It is also a personal journey of self-discovery because we are product of our culture & tradition. As a photographer, I find worth in my talent as it can contribute important part in the history of our region. We are not just photographers. We are storytellers that can educate the next generation. We are historians who capture the time in presenting the actual image of our identity.
